In short: NO.

First off, laptop processors are soldered in and not upgradable. Then because laptops are designed for portability, the designers place low power, so it doesn't drain the battery fast as their priority. This also makes sense because of a laptop's inherent crammed space and very tough to vent any extra heat produced.

The only upgrade you *maybe* possible to your laptop are: switch HD to SSD and max out ram if you are swapping a lot.
